Autorizzazioni per la cartella di ricezione per Team Foundation Build

Aggiornamento: novembre 2007

La cartella di ricezione di Team Foundation Build è il percorso in cui vengono pubblicati i file binari compilati, i file di log della compilazione e i file di log dei risultati del test generati durante il processo di compilazione. L'account del servizio utilizzato per eseguire il processo di compilazione deve disporre delle autorizzazioni appropriate per la cartella di ricezione specificata. Per pubblicare i risultati del test, è necessario che l'account del servizio Visual Studio Team Foundation Server utilizzato per l'esecuzione dei servizi Web disponga delle stesse autorizzazioni della cartella di ricezione.

Configurazione dell'account del servizio di compilazione sull'agente di compilazione

Quando si configura un agente di compilazione, è necessario essere un amministratore sul computer specificato. È inoltre necessario fornire un account del servizio di compilazione valido che verrà utilizzato per il processo di compilazione.

Nota importante:

Non utilizzare l'account di servizio di Team Foundation Server per eseguire il servizio di compilazione.

Account del servizio di compilazione:

Autorizzazioni obbligatorie per l'account del servizio di compilazione nella cartella di ricezione

L'account del servizio di compilazione deve disporre delle seguenti autorizzazioni:

  • Nel caso di un particolare agente di compilazione, per copiare le compilazioni in una cartella, è necessario che l'account del servizio di compilazione disponga del Controllo completo alla cartella di ricezione condivisa. In Windows Vista o Windows Server 2008 l'account deve essere un co-proprietario della cartella di ricezione.

  • Se si includono test nel processo di compilazione, l'account del servizio di compilazione deve disporre dell'autorizzazione Pubblica risultati test.

  • Per pubblicare automaticamente i risultati di un unit test in Team Foundation Build, l'account del servizio livello applicazione deve disporre del Controllo completo alla cartella di ricezione.

  • Affinché i singoli utenti possano pubblicare i risultati dell'unit test (dall'IDE di Visual Studio, da MSTest.exe o da una compilazione desktop di tfsbuild.proj), devono disporre dell'autorizzazione di scrittura per la cartella di ricezione.

Vedere anche

Attività

Risoluzione dei problemi relativi alle cartelle di destinazione di Team Foundation

Concetti

Opzioni della riga di comando di MSTest.exe